OPENCV :从图像左边缘开始计算像素
OPENCV : count pixel from the left edge of the image
我想知道如何循环来计算图像像素 从图像左边缘开始计算像素
如何使用C ++ OpenCV做到这一点
你不需要
自己构建循环,这一切都已经为你完成了。
cv::Mat img = cv::imread("img.jpg");
std::cout << img.total() << std::endl;
第一行将图像加载到标准C++ OpenCV 容器Mat
中。第二行打印Mat
底层数组中的元素数量,如果是图像,这等于该图像的像素总数。
如果这些构造对您来说是新的,您应该从阅读这些教程开始。
相关文章:
- 为什么"do while"循环不断退出,即使条件计算结果为 false?
- 当回溯以零开始时,如何调试崩溃
- 递归函数计算序列中的平方和(并输出过程)
- (C++)分析树以计算返回错误值的简单算术表达式
- 我的字符计数代码计算错误.为什么
- 在计算中使用二的幂有多有利可图
- 如何计算文件中的"columns"数?
- 计算排序向量的向量中唯一值的计数
- 如何使用 std::累积在 C++ 中计算总和立方体
- 使用Qt C++计算类似Git的SHA1哈希
- OpenCV C++.快速计算混淆矩阵
- cpp二进制搜索问题,计算给定数组中输入元素的出现次数
- C++如何计算用户输入的数字中的偶数位数
- 如何计算数据类型的范围,例如int
- 如何使用 C 连续输出自计算开始以来的秒数
- 根据给定的年份和周数计算开始和结束日期/时间
- OPENCV :从图像左边缘开始计算像素
- 从日期开始计算一年中的某一天
- 从午夜开始计算毫秒数
- C++函数,从double开始进行基数为10的有效+指数计算